Martina chose a random sample of 10 bags of candy from two different Brands, A and B. All bags in the sample are the same size. Martina counts the number of candy pieces in each bag and plots the results on two dot plots.
A dot plot is shown. The title of the plot is Brand A. The line is numbered with tick marks at 40, 45, 50, 55, 60, 65, and 70 and is labeled Number of Candy Pieces. There are 2 dots at 52, 1 dot at 53, 2 dots at 55, 1 dot at 56, 2 dots at 57, and 2 dots at 62. A dot plot is shown. The title of the plot is Brand B. The line is numbered with tick marks at 40, 45, 50, 55, 60, 65, and 70 and is labeled Number of Candy Pieces. There is 1 dot at 44, 1 dot at 46, 2 dots at 52, 1 dot at 55, 1 dot at 62, 1 dot at 65, 2 dots at 67 and 1 dot at 69
Based on the plots, which statement is a valid comparison of the number of candies in the bags of the two Brands?
A. The number of candies in the bags from Brand B is greater and more consistent than the number of candies in the bags from Brand A.
B. The number of candies in the bags from Brand B is greater and less consistent than the number of candies in the bags from Brand A.
C. The number of candies in the bags from Brand B is fewer and more consistent than the number of candies in the bags from Brand A.
D. The number of candies in the bags from brand B is fewer and less consistent than the number of candies in the bags from brand A.

Suppose three people ate a meal in a restaurant. The cost of each of their meals is m. One person intends to tip 10%, the second person intends to tip 15%, and the third person intends to tip 20%. Which expression represents the total amount that they'll pay?
A. 1.1m + 1.15m + 1.2m
B. 0.1m + 0.15m + 0.2m
C. 1.1m + 2.15m + 3.2m
D. 1 + 0.1m + 1 + 0.15m + 1 + 0.2m
For this case we have:
m represents the total cost of each meal. If people do not pay a tip, the total cost to pay would be:
[tex]m + m + m = 3m\\[/tex]
Person 1:
Without tip the cost of your meal is m.
You want to pay 10% tip
m -------------------> 100%
x --------------------> 10%
[tex]x =\frac{(10)(m)}{100} = 0.1m\\[/tex]
Thus, its cost will be:
[tex]C1 = m + 0.1m = 1.1m\\[/tex]
Person 2:
Without tip the cost of your meal is m.
m -------------------> 100%
x --------------------> 15%
[tex]x =\frac{(15)(m)}{100} = 0.15m\\[/tex]
Thus, its cost will be:
[tex]C2 = m + 0.15m = 1.15m\\[/tex]
Person 3:
Without tip the cost of your meal is m.
m -------------------> 100%
x --------------------> 20%
[tex]x =\frac{(20)(m)}{100} = 0.20m\\[/tex]
Thus, its cost will be:
[tex]C3 = m + 0.20m = 1.20m\\[/tex]
Thus, the total cost to pay will be:
[tex]C = 1.1m + 1.15m + 1.20m\\[/tex]
Answer:
[tex]C = 1.1m + 1.15m + 1.20m[/tex]
